The Department of Forest Engineering, Resources Management at Oregon State University in Corvallis is dedicated to supporting decisions for healthy and sustainable forests. Their teaching and research focus on all aspects of active forest management and restoration, including regeneration, harvest, and multiple land use objectives.
They offer academic programs in Forestry, Forest Engineering, and Sustainable Forest Management at the undergraduate and graduate levels. Their labs provide hands-on learning experiences about the forest, its resources, and the use of tools and instruments. With a commitment to outdoor education, they strive to create an exciting and immersive learning environment for their students.
